excel水印怎么设置?置顶方法详解
作者:佚名|分类:EXCEL|浏览:162|发布时间:2025-04-11 08:18:08
Excel水印怎么设置?置顶方法详解
在办公软件中,Excel作为数据处理和分析的重要工具,经常需要保护文档内容不被泄露。设置水印是一种常见的保护措施,可以有效地防止他人未经授权查看或复制文档内容。本文将详细介绍如何在Excel中设置水印,并提供置顶方法详解。
一、Excel水印设置方法
1. 打开Excel文档,点击“文件”菜单,选择“选项”。
2. 在弹出的“Excel选项”窗口中,找到“高级”选项卡。
3. 在“显示”区域,勾选“在屏幕上显示此工作表标签”复选框。
4. 点击“确定”按钮,此时工作表标签将显示在屏幕上。
5. 右键点击工作表标签,选择“查看代码”。
6. 在打开的VBA代码编辑器中,找到以下代码:
```
Sub SetWatermark()
With ActiveSheet.PageSetup
.PrintArea = ""
.PrintTitleRows = ""
.PrintTitleColumns = ""
.LeftHeader = ""
.CenterHeader = ""
.RightHeader = ""
.LeftFooter = ""
.CenterFooter = "水印内容"
.RightFooter = ""
.TopMargin = 0.5
.BottomMargin = 0.5
.HeaderMargin = 0.5
.FooterMargin = 0.5
.PrintHeadings = False
.PrintGridlines = False
.PrintQuality = 600
.CenterHorizontally = True
.CenterVertically = True
.PrintRange = ""
.FromTo = False
.Item = xlPrintAllSheets
.Order = xlBottomToTop
.Orientation = xlPortrait
.PaperSize = xlPaperA4
.FirstPageNumber = 0
.EndPageNumber = 0
.NumberPages = False
.IncludeLabels = False
.IncludeHeadings = False
.IncludeGridlines = False
.IncludeNotes = False
.IncludeComments = False
.EvenPagesFirst = False
.Dpi = 96
.PrintErrors = xlPrintErrorsNone
.ActivePrinter = ""
.PrintRange = ""
.Collate = True
End With
End Sub
```
7. 将“水印内容”替换为你想要显示的水印文字。
8. 关闭VBA代码编辑器,回到Excel界面。
9. 按下快捷键“Alt + F8”,在弹出的“宏”窗口中,选择“SetWatermark”,点击“运行”。
10. 此时,你将在工作表标签上看到设置好的水印。
二、Excel水印置顶方法详解
1. 打开Excel文档,点击“文件”菜单,选择“选项”。
2. 在弹出的“Excel选项”窗口中,找到“高级”选项卡。
3. 在“显示”区域,勾选“在屏幕上显示此工作表标签”复选框。
4. 点击“确定”按钮,此时工作表标签将显示在屏幕上。
5. 右键点击工作表标签,选择“查看代码”。
6. 在打开的VBA代码编辑器中,找到以下代码:
```
Sub SetWatermarkTop()
With ActiveSheet.PageSetup
.PrintArea = ""
.PrintTitleRows = ""
.PrintTitleColumns = ""
.LeftHeader = ""
.CenterHeader = ""
.RightHeader = ""
.LeftFooter = ""
.CenterFooter = "水印内容"
.RightFooter = ""
.TopMargin = 0.5
.BottomMargin = 0.5
.HeaderMargin = 0.5
.FooterMargin = 0.5
.PrintHeadings = False
.PrintGridlines = False
.PrintQuality = 600
.CenterHorizontally = True
.CenterVertically = True
.PrintRange = ""
.FromTo = False
.Item = xlPrintAllSheets
.Order = xlBottomToTop
.Orientation = xlPortrait
.PaperSize = xlPaperA4
.FirstPageNumber = 0
.EndPageNumber = 0
.NumberPages = False
.IncludeLabels = False
.IncludeHeadings = False
.IncludeGridlines = False
.IncludeNotes = False
.IncludeComments = False
.EvenPagesFirst = False
.Dpi = 96
.PrintErrors = xlPrintErrorsNone
.ActivePrinter = ""
.PrintRange = ""
.Collate = True
End With
End Sub
```
7. 将“水印内容”替换为你想要显示的水印文字。
8. 关闭VBA代码编辑器,回到Excel界面。
9. 按下快捷键“Alt + F8”,在弹出的“宏”窗口中,选择“SetWatermarkTop”,点击“运行”。
10. 此时,你将在工作表标签上看到设置好的水印,且水印将置顶显示。
三、相关问答
1. 问:如何删除Excel中的水印?
答: 右键点击工作表标签,选择“查看代码”,在VBA代码编辑器中找到设置水印的代码,将其删除或注释掉,然后关闭代码编辑器,回到Excel界面,水印将消失。
2. 问:水印设置后,如何调整水印位置?
答: 在VBA代码编辑器中,修改`.CenterHorizontally`和`.CenterVertically`的值,可以调整水印的水平方向和垂直方向位置。
3. 问:水印设置后,如何调整水印大小?
答: 在VBA代码编辑器中,修改`.TopMargin`和`.BottomMargin`的值,可以调整水印的上下间距,从而间接调整水印大小。
4. 问:水印设置后,如何调整水印颜色?
答: 在VBA代码编辑器中,修改`.CenterFooter`的值,将其设置为所需颜色的RGB值,例如`"FF0000"`表示红色。
通过以上方法,你可以在Excel中轻松设置水印,并实现水印置顶。希望本文对你有所帮助。
(注:本文内容仅供参考,具体操作可能因Excel版本不同而有所差异。)